Delivery: Verbal Gestures
 Avoid using negative aspects
when speaking, it can be very
irritating:
 “um”, “er”, “yeah”, “uh”, “you
know”, “OK”, and other kinds of
nervous verbal habits.
 Instead of saying "uh," or "you
know" etc. every three seconds, try
not saying anything at all.
Delivery: Body Language
The gestures, poses, movements, and expressions
that a person uses to communicate.
Very important to make a presentation more
convincing.
Includes:
 Eye contact.
 Facial expression.
 Use of the hands.
 Posture and movement.
Delivery: Hand Gestures
 To emphasize points.
 Draws the attention of the audience.
 Aiding clarification.
 Not too much hand waving.
 Can be distracting and a bit comical.
 Use the hands in different ways.
 In general, make only occasional hand gestures.
 Plan to keep your hands clasped together, or;
 Holding on to the podium, cue cards, etc.
 Be careful!
 Development of particular habits; some can be irritating.
 Try to avoid habitual behaviors using your hands (fumbling
change in pocket, or twirling the chair in front of you, for
example).
